  • Patent number: 6309292
    Abstract: A rotary tool for the erasure-type abrading of adhesive residues and foil, in particular, from lacquered metal surfaces has an outer tooth crown of rubber or an elastomeric synthetic resin, the teeth being bendable. The tooth disk is mounted on a disk-shaped holder which is rotatably driven and is coupled to the latter by an inner crown.

  • Patent number: 5524315
    Abstract: A rotatable brush can have its steel bristles anchored in an endless bendable band which fits on a spacer sleeve of a holder bridging two end disks thereof. The disks can have axial ribs which are spaced from the sleeve and pass through gaps in the bristles. On these ribs or the spacer at least one axial groove is provided in which a key of the band is engaged. The key can be a clip or staple holding the ends of the band together.

  • Patent number: 5323505
    Abstract: A brush assembly adapted to be rotated about an axis has a brush having a flexible, annular and generally cylindrical collar generally centered on the axis and having a predetermined and generally uniform radial thickness, a predetermined inside diameter, and a predetermined axial length, and a plurality of arrays of radially projecting bristles angularly equispaced about the collar and defining a plurality of axially throughgoing and angularly equispaced bristle-free zones. A holder drum has a core having an outer surface centered on the axis and having a predetermined outside diameter substantially smaller than the inside diameter of the collar, inner and outer end flanges axially flanking the core paced axially apart by a predetermined axial distance greater than the axial length of the collar so that the collar is received with axial play between the flanges, and respective retaining tongues extending axially between the flanges in the bristle-free zones of the brush.

  • Patent number: 5177830
    Abstract: A rotatively driveable tool chucking device with at least two chucking disks and a common tightening screw for chucking a tool sleeve between the two chucking disks. The chucking disks have concentric annular grooves for chucking tool sleeves with essentially the same diameter. When the sleeves are of flexible material, they are rotationally stabilized about the central axis of rotation, without requiring a rubber core or similar support body. This stabilization maintains the sleeves always in cylindrical shape.
